Join our ever-growing, dynamic Gloucestershire Group for our next meet-up on Thursday 20 November from 2pm.
We held one of these meet-ups earlier in the year, which proved very popular. This further session will give those of us trying to master one or more IT problems or social media platforms the chance to pair up with others who feel more confident to advise. As this is a hands-on session, attendees are asked to bring along the tablets, laptops or phones on which they write and/or have loaded their social media. As usual there will also be time for news exchange and chat.
The venue has great accessibility: it’s the ground-floor meeting room within the Monastery Café building at Prinknash Abbey, Cranham, GL4 8EX. There is a large, free car park, above the café building. Walk down steps or a gentle slope to access the café entrance. The meeting room is immediately to your left on entering, with toilets opposite. The café to the right serves a great selection of non-alcoholic refreshments, delicious cake etc.
If you have accessibility issues, keep driving: there are two disabled spaces just to the left of the doorway. While the café is generously offering us the meeting room free of charge, please bring a plastic card or cash to pay for your own refreshments.
